Display Proteins
- mRFP Derivatives
- mRFP1 The original
- tdTomato [1]
- Brightest
- Best quantum Yield
- Double the molecular weight though
- mCherry [2]
- Longest wavelengths
- Highest photostability
- Fastest maturation
- Excellent pH resistance
- Quantum efficiency is slightly lower (0.22 versus 0.25 for mRFP1)
- Higher extinction coefficient (due to near-complete maturation)
- Tolerance of N-terminal fusions and photostability make mRFP1 obsolete
